A vibrant social care organisation in Holytown is looking for a Service Manager focused on improving the quality of services for individuals with learning disabilities. The successful candidate will manage local teams and ensure effective communication with families and professionals.

Candidates must have significant experience in supported living services and relevant SVQ qualifications. This role offers opportunities for career development and various staff benefits, including health cash plans and qualification funding.

How to prepare for a job interview at Enable Scotland

✨Know Your Stuff

Make sure you brush up on your knowledge of supported living services and the specific needs of individuals with learning disabilities. Familiarise yourself with the latest best practices and any relevant legislation, as this will show your commitment to improving service quality.

✨Showcase Your Leadership Skills

As a Service Manager, you'll be leading local teams. Prepare examples of how you've successfully managed teams in the past, focusing on effective communication and collaboration. Think about times when you've resolved conflicts or improved team dynamics.

✨Engage with Real Scenarios

Be ready to discuss real-life scenarios that demonstrate your problem-solving skills. Consider challenges you’ve faced in previous roles and how you overcame them, especially in relation to improving service delivery and communication with families and professionals.

✨Ask Insightful Questions

Prepare thoughtful questions to ask during the interview. This could include inquiries about the organisation's approach to staff development or how they measure the success of their services. It shows you're genuinely interested and thinking about how you can contribute.
